利用 BeanUtils 将 Map 与 Bean 进行相互转换(把 map 值放入 Bean 的属性中)

map -》 Bean

BeanUtils.populate(Object bean, Map<String, ? extends Object> properties);

Bean -》 Map

BeanMap testMap = new BeanMap(Object bean);

利用 BeanUtils 将 Map 与 Bean 进行相互转换(把 map 值放入 Bean 的属性中)_第1张图片


需要添加的 Maven 依赖

        
        <dependency>
            <groupId>commons-beanutilsgroupId>
            <artifactId>commons-beanutilsartifactId>
            <version>1.9.3version>
        dependency>

参考资料:

1、Map和Bean的相互转换
https://www.cnblogs.com/jing1617/p/7007580.html

你可能感兴趣的:(Java基础)